Anindith Reddy sets Kari circuit ablaze

October 08, 2016 09:08 pm | Updated 09:08 pm IST - Coimbatore:

International stunt driver Terry Grant from the United Kingdom will enthral the crowd on Sunday with his jaw-dropping stunts.

Hyderabad’s Anindith Reddy came up with a stunning double victory in the race for the Euro JK 16 cars, the premium class of the 19th JK Tyre FMSCI National Racing championship at the Kari Motor Speedway in Chettipalayam here on Saturday.

The 26-year-old, with his double win, has now climbed up to the third spot in the championship table. With two more races scheduled for Sunday, the gritty youngster is expected to continue with his good performances and may well threaten the table toppers as they head for the final round at the Buddh International Circuit next month.

Sheer pace and skill

Anindith did not have a great qualifying round but exhibited sheer pace, skill and determination on his way to winning the much-talked about races for the day. He clearly made-up for his disastrous second round, in which he collected just five points, at the very same circuit last month.

“I decided to play it safe in the first lap after what happened in the last round. And, it was also a question of being consistent,” said Anindith.

Bangalore’s Ananth Shanmugam and Mumbai’s Mohammed Nalwalla finished for the next two positions in both the races.

But it was a rather quiet day for championship leader Nayan Chatterjee of Mumbai. He had to rest content with the fourth spot in both races and still holds a slender four-point edge over Ananth Shanmugam.

However, there was no such surprises in the LGB Formula 4 and JK Touring car categories. Both Vishnu Prasad and Asish Ramaswamy won their respective categories with a bit of ease.

Terry to enthral crowd

Meanwhile there was something extra special for the spectators on Sunday. JK Tyre has roped in international stunt driver Terry Grant for the big occasion.

The 23-time world record holder from the United Kingdom is expected to come up with a new set of jaw-dropping stunts that may well have the crowd on the edge of their seats.

Terry is regarded as the greatest performers in the business having performed for some of the biggest car manufacturers across the world.

The results (provisional, day one): Euro JK 16: Race 1: 1. Anindith Reddy 15:47.319; 2. Ananth Shanmugam 15:49.236; 3. Mohammed Nalwalla 15:53.799. Race 2: 1. Anindith 17:20.512; 2. Ananth 17:22.979; 3. Mohammed 17:23.637.

LGB Formula 4: Race 1: 1. Vishnu Prasad 19:58.283; 2. Raghul Rangasamy 19:58.303; 3. Rohit Khanna 20:08.290.

JK Touring Cars: Race 1: 1. Asish Ramaswamy 14:16.606; 2. Deepak Chinnappa 14:24.043; 3. B. Vijayakumar 14:25.395 .
